Frequently Asked Questions
Are there any fees to play on the courts at Warsaw Middle School?
No, there are no fees to play on the courts at Warsaw Middle School. The use of the courts is free and open to the public. However, please note that you will need to bring your own nets and equipment as they are not provided at the facility.
How many indoor pickleball courts are available at Warsaw Middle School?
There are two indoor pickleball courts available at Warsaw Middle School.
